"Inseparable from the Georgian architecture of Great Britain and New England, the fanlight, or overdoor, developed and flourished for a mere fifty years in the 18th century. Installed to provide light to narrow entrance hallways, this practical window became the subject of some of the most delightful and intricate decoration in domestic building. Over 200 fanlights drawn by Charlotte Halliday handsomely illustrate this first monograph on the subject." FINE HARDCOVER, FINE DUST JACKET. Size: 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all.
